We compared two Desktop platform GPUs: 8GB VRAM CMP 40HX and 128MB VRAM Quadro FX 550 to see which GPU has better performance in key specifications, benchmark tests, power consumption, etc.
Main Differences
NVIDIA CMP 40HX 's Advantages
Released 14 years and 10 months late
Boost Clock1650MHz
More VRAM (8GB vs 128GB)
Larger VRAM bandwidth (448.0GB/s vs 12.80GB/s)
2304 additional rendering cores
NVIDIA Quadro FX 550 's Advantages
Lower TDP (30W vs 185W)
